This condition occurs when the soil beneath your house shifts and settles. The Kansas City metro area has some of the most expansive soil in America. Clay is an expansive soil and is extremely common in the Kansas City area. Clay dirt is a prime example of the expansive soil seen when dealing with new home construction in our area. Clay dirt swells when the minerals in the clay absorb water from rain, underground springs or watering of a lawn. U.S. Geological Survey states that a 10 inch-thick clay mineral can expand to 19.5 inches in water. What does this mean to your home? |
